Several factors help determine whether repair or replacement makes more sense for Fort Washington homeowners. If your system is over 15 years old and requiring frequent repairs, replacement typically offers better long-term value. Rising energy bills, uneven temperatures throughout your home, or loud operational noises often indicate declining efficiency that suggests replacement time has arrived. Proper HVAC system sizing depends on multiple factors including your home’s square footage, insulation levels, window placement, and local climate conditions here in Montgomery County. Many Fort Washington homes have oversized or undersized equipment installed by previous contractors who didn’t perform detailed load calculations. Central Plumbing uses industry-standard Manual J calculations to determine exact BTU requirements for both heating and cooling, ensuring optimal efficiency and comfort. Our experience with Fort Washington’s mix of historic and newer homes helps us account for unique architectural features that affect heating and cooling needs. Proper sizing prevents short-cycling, reduces energy costs, and extends equipment life significantly.
